无论是数据存储、应用部署还是业务扩展,云服务器都以其灵活性、可扩展性和成本效益赢得了广泛认可
然而,要充分发挥云服务器的潜力,首先需确保能够顺畅、安全地连接到这些远程服务器
本文将详细介绍如何高效查看并管理云服务器连接,帮助您轻松驾驭云端之旅
一、理解云服务器连接的基础 1.1 云服务器的基本概念 云服务器,又称虚拟服务器,是通过虚拟化技术在物理服务器上创建的独立运算环境
每个云服务器拥有自己的操作系统、存储空间和计算能力,用户可通过互联网远程访问和管理
1.2 连接云服务器的两种方式 - SSH(Secure Shell):这是最常用的连接方式,通过命令行界面进行远程登录和管理,适用于Linux系统
SSH加密传输数据,保证了连接的安全性
- 远程桌面协议(RDP/VNC):主要用于Windows云服务器,允许用户图形化界面远程操作服务器,如同操作本地计算机一样直观
二、准备工作:确保连接前的必要条件 2.1 获取云服务器的访问凭证 - IP地址:云服务器的唯一网络地址,用于定位服务器
用户名:登录云服务器所需的账户名
- 密码/密钥对:身份验证的关键,密码较为简单直接,而密钥对则提供了更高的安全性
2.2 配置安全组/防火墙规则 云服务商的安全组或服务器的防火墙设置需允许您的客户端IP地址通过SSH(一般为端口22)或RDP(默认为端口3389)等所需端口进行访问
2.3 安装必要的客户端软件 - SSH客户端:如PuTTY(Windows)、Terminal(macOS/Linux)等,用于通过SSH协议连接Linux服务器
- 远程桌面客户端:如Microsoft Remote Desktop(跨平台)、VNC Viewer等,适用于Windows服务器的图形化远程访问
三、实际操作:查看并管理云服务器连接 3.1 使用SSH连接Linux云服务器 步骤一:打开SSH客户端 - 在Windows上,启动PuTTY并输入云服务器的IP地址,选择SSH作为连接类型
- 在macOS或Linux上,打开Terminal,输入`ssh 用户名@IP地址`
步骤二:身份验证 - 如果使用密码登录,系统会提示输入密码并按回车
- 若使用密钥对,确保私钥文件路径正确,且私钥文件权限设置合理(通常为600)
步骤三:验证连接 成功登录后,您将看到服务器的命令行提示符,此时即可开始管理服务器
3.2 使用远程桌面连接Windows云服务器 步骤一:配置远程桌面服务 - 登录Windows云服务器的控制台,确保“远程桌面”功能已启用(在系统属性中的“远程”选项卡)
步骤二:打开远程桌面客户端 - 在本地计算机上,启动Microsoft Remote Desktop或VNC Viewer
- 新建连接,输入云服务器的IP地址及登录凭据
步骤三:建立连接 - 根据提示完成身份验证,即可进入Windows云服务器的桌面环境
3.3 查看和管理连接状态 实时监控 - 利用云服务商提供的控制台,可以查看云服务器的实时状态、网络流量、CPU和内存使用情况等关键指标
- 在SSH或远程桌面会话中,可以使用`top`、`htop`(Linux)或任务管理器(Windows)等工具监控资源使用情况
优化连接性能 - 带宽调整:确保网络带宽充足,避免因网络拥堵影响连接速度
- 使用压缩:SSH连接时,可以启用压缩选项(如PuTTY中的“Enable compression”),减少数据传输时间
- 定期维护:定期更新服务器操作系统和软件,清理不必要的服务和文件,保持系统轻盈高效
安全管理 - 定期更换密码/密钥:增强账户安全性,避免被恶意攻击者利用
- 使用VPN/SSH隧道:增加数据传输的安全性,尤其是当连接公共Wi-Fi时
- 配置失败2FA(双重认证):为云账户添加额外一层保护,即使密码泄露也能有效阻止未授权访问
四、解决常见问题与故障排除 4.1 无法连接到服务器 - 检查IP地址和端口:确保输入的IP地址和端口号正确无误
- 验证安全组设置:检查云服务商的安全组或防火墙规则,确保相关端口已开放
- 服务器状态:确认服务器已启动并运行正常,必要时重启服务器尝试
4.2 连接速度慢 - 网络测试:使用ping或traceroute工具检查网络连接质量
调整带宽:联系云服务商升级网络带宽
- 优化服务器配置:关闭不必要的服务,减少系统负载
4.3 登录认证失败 - 密码/密钥错误:重新检查输入的用户名和密码/密钥是否正确
- 账户锁定:多次错误尝试可能导致账户被锁定,需联系云服务商解锁
五、总结与展望 掌握如何高效查看并管理云服务器连接,是每位IT运维人员的基本技能
通过理解连接基础